  • Abstract
    The characteristic of a large-scale array antenna of arbitrary geometry element was analyzed using the fast multipole method (FMM) combined with fast Fourier transform (FFT). The memory requirement and the CPU time are reduced effectively compared with conventional computational complexity of FMM. Some numerical results are given to show the efficiency of the method in this research. It should be noted that the multilevel fast multipole algorithm (MLFMA) can also be combined with FFT to further reduce the computational complexity
